4 GHz to 8.5 GHz, GaAs, MMIC, I/Q Mixer
Key Features
• Wide intermediate frequency (IF) bandwidth: dc to 3.5 GHz
• Image rejection: 40 dB
• Local oscillator (LO) to radio frequency (RF) isolation:50 dB
• High input IP3: 23 dBm
• Die size (HMC525): 1.49 mm × 1.14 mm × 0.1 mm
• RoHS compliant 4 mm × 4 mm SMT package (HMC525LC4)

The HMC525 devices are compact I/Q MMIC mixers that are available in a chip (HMC525) or a leadless Pb-free RoHS compliant SMT package (HMC525LC4), both of which can be used as either an IRM or a single sideband (SSB) upconverter. The mixers utilize two standard Hittite double-balanced mixer cells and a 90° hybrid fabricated in a GaAs metal semiconductor field effect transistor (MESFET) process. A low frequency quadrature hybrid was used to produce a 100 MHz USB IF output. These products are much smaller alternatives to hybrid style IRMs and SSB upconverter assemblies. All data shown for the HMC525 is taken with the chip mounted in a 50 Ω test fixture and includes the effects of 1 mil diameter × 20 mil length bond wires on each port.
